Two Pinoys killed in Saudi Arabia road accident
Two Filipinos were killed while a child was injured in a road accident in Jeddah in Saudi Arabia, radio reports said Saturday.
A report on Radyo Mo Nationwide said the incident occurred in Obhur in Jeddah, when a Porsche sports car hit the vehicle the victims were riding.
Sketchy initial reports showed the victims – a male and a female – were on their way to a photography event when the incident occurred.
Initial details indicated the female died on the spot while the male died while being brought to a hospital.
A four-year-old child who was with the couple was injured in the incident, the report added.
Philippine officials in Jeddah have dispatched a team to gather more information about the incident, according to a separate report on dzRH radio. — LBG, GMA News
